Transaction

be801f0f6306856332e33538baa2817042b9ca33184971439498aee39f2e0a35

Summary

In Block487316
TimeSun, 17 Dec 2023 05:17:15 UTC
Total Input878.23681031 Nebula
Total Output912.23681031 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
222193 Confirmations912.23681031 Nebula
Raw Transaction